Maharashtra: Two killed, one injured as speeding car crashes into Metro station pillar in Pune

"A car hit a pillar of the Bund Garden Metro station. As per the primary information, two persons in the car died while the third person sustained serious injuries," senior police inspector Sangita Jadhav said

Two people were killed and one was seriously injured after their speeding car rammed into the pillar of a Metro station in Maharashtra's Pune city early on Sunday, police said, reported news agency PTI.

The incident took place at around 4.30 am in the Bund Garden area, an official from Koregaon Park police station said.
